[zstd] zstd packages for armv7h not in repos or any mirrors
0%
Description
When running the update on a armv7h device, it errors with 404 and the package fails to be downloaded, causing the update to error and fail. After further inspection of https://repo.parabola.nu/core/os/armv7h/zstd-1.5.2-2-armv7h.pkg.tar.xz and the file tree, the package seems to not be in the repos as it is for the other architectures. Looking at other mirrors in sync, it is not there either. Not sure if its intentional or not.

Hi,
There is also curl and dosfstools missing.
I've looked a bit at this and compared some packages.
Between bzip2 and zstd from archlinux arm armv7h the .BUILDINFO is different. We have something like that:
-format = 1 +format = 2 +startdir = /startdir +buildtool = makepkg +buildtoolver = 6.0.1 +options = !lto
Between curl from arch linux x86_64 and curl from archlinux arm armv7h the format is the same but we still have differences:
-buildtool = devtools +buildtool = makepkg -buildtoolver = 20220126-1-any +buildtoolver = 6.0.1 -buildenv = !distcc +buildenv = distcc +options = !upx -options = lto +options = !lto

For dosfstools
I added a package in pcr
for armv7h
.
I've not blacklisted it since i686
and x86_64
use the one coming from arch.
So for upgrades it still tries to download dosfstools from core.
I've now removed the armv7h dosfstools from core.db (and accidentally from pcr.db so I'll re-upload the package). So we need to see if that sticks or not.
In any case we can still manually install dosfstools from pcr with pacman -S pcr/dosfstools
and the upgrade will work again. Though that might not work for pacstrap unless we specify to install dosfstools manually (so that might break libremakepkg
for instance).
